Fitness centerAbout the Club
The Box Fitness Center is Fort Irwinβs premier Gym located at the Resiliency Campus featuring all of todayβs most modern fitness equipment. The Box features a central floor, family room, boxing room, and saunas. It offers extensive programming including but not limited to all Intro series classes, quarterly events and club series events.
The Box Fitness Center is also the home of the NTC Weightlifting club and host a fully certified and credentialed Fitness Center Staff. The Box is open daily to Active-Duty Service Members and Families, Retirees and Family Members. DOD APF/NAF civilian employees, DOD contractors etc. With adjusted hours for block leave and weekend. Key FOB needed for after hours and weekend entry via a onetime $7 fee.

Great space! Free weight friendly gym, little to no machines.
Lots of rowers, 3 assault bikes, 2 ski-ergs, 2 20 space crossfit rigs, 2 squat racks, 3 deadlift platforms, Atlas Stones from 45-225#, Yoke, Sleds, Sandbags, Kettlebells, Dumbells, climbing walls, peg board, sledges and tire outside. Lots of BenchBar (Kabuki) options to check out from the desk.
Crossfit M,W,F (05-06 and 18-19)
